The AMD Ryzen 7 9800X3D, boasting an impressive 8-core CPU with the innovative 3D V-Cache technology, has taken the gaming world by storm. Heralded as the ultimate gaming processor, it has quickly earned a reputation as the reigning champion, even leading some to humorously declare a premature end to Intel’s dominance. However, this meteoric rise in popularity has led to an unexpected problem: widespread scarcity.
Almost as soon as the curtain rose on the sales event, eager customers were met with “out of stock” notices. Retailers have been swamped by preorders, causing many to hit pause on sales until they can restock. For those in the United States, the path to securing one of these coveted processors feels like a game of cat and mouse, often ending in disappointment. The situation isn’t much better across the pond, with scarce availability throughout Europe, suggesting AMD may have underestimated demand and been caught off-guard by the fervor.
AMD has captured images of eager customers forming lines at physical stores as purchasing in-person becomes one of the few viable options to snag this hot ticket item. But with scarcity comes another challenge: the resurgence of scalpers. The Ryzen 7 9800X3D has found its way to secondary marketplaces, with prices inflated to eye-watering levels. Listings ranging from $650 to $999 have made appearance, well above the Manufacturer’s Suggested Retail Price (MSRP). This means buyers might reluctantly dig deeper into their pockets, with some splurging around $700 to $740, excluding shipping, to make this prized processor theirs.
For those not wanting to play into scalpers’ hands, patience will be their best ally. Allowing market frenzy to simmer down over the coming weeks or even months is likely the smart, steady approach for anyone eyeing the 9800X3D without breaking the bank.
